博客 实时数据融合与渲染的技术实现与优化

实时数据融合与渲染的技术实现与优化

   数栈君   发表于 2026-01-06 20:41  84  0

在当今数字化转型的浪潮中,实时数据的处理与可视化呈现已成为企业提升竞争力的关键能力。实时数据融合与渲染技术作为这一过程的核心,帮助企业将复杂的数据转化为直观、动态的可视化界面,为决策者提供实时洞察。本文将深入探讨实时数据融合与渲染的技术实现与优化方法,为企业和个人提供实用的指导。


什么是实时数据融合与渲染?

实时数据融合与渲染是指将来自多个数据源的实时数据进行整合、处理,并通过图形化界面实时呈现的过程。这一技术广泛应用于数据中台、数字孪生、实时可视化等领域,能够帮助企业快速响应数据变化,提升业务效率。

  • 数据融合:将来自不同系统、格式和时区的数据进行整合,确保数据的一致性和完整性。
  • 数据渲染:将融合后的数据通过图形化工具呈现,如图表、3D模型、地图等,使数据更易于理解和分析。

技术实现

实时数据融合与渲染的技术实现涉及多个环节,包括数据采集、数据处理、数据融合、数据渲染等。以下将详细探讨每个环节的技术要点。

1. 数据采集与预处理

数据采集是实时数据融合的第一步,需要从多个数据源(如数据库、API、物联网设备等)获取实时数据。常见的数据采集方式包括:

  • 数据库采集:通过JDBC、ODBC等接口从关系型数据库中获取数据。
  • API接口采集:通过RESTful API或WebSocket从第三方服务获取实时数据。
  • 物联网设备采集:通过MQTT、HTTP等协议从物联网设备获取传感器数据。

在数据采集后,需要进行预处理,包括:

  • 数据清洗:去除重复、错误或无效的数据。
  • 数据转换:将数据转换为统一的格式,如时间戳、数值类型等。
  • 数据增强:对数据进行补充,如添加地理位置、设备信息等元数据。

2. 数据融合

数据融合是将预处理后的数据进行整合的过程,目标是消除数据孤岛,形成统一的数据视图。常见的数据融合方法包括:

  • 特征对齐:将不同数据源的特征进行对齐,确保数据的可比性。
  • 模型融合:通过机器学习模型对多源数据进行融合,生成更准确的预测结果。
  • 规则融合:基于业务规则对数据进行融合,如优先使用高精度数据源。

3. 数据渲染

数据渲染是将融合后的数据通过图形化工具呈现的过程,目标是将抽象的数据转化为直观的可视化界面。常见的数据渲染方式包括:

  • 2D图表渲染:使用折线图、柱状图、散点图等图表类型展示数据趋势和分布。
  • 3D模型渲染:通过3D图形库(如WebGL、WebGPU)渲染三维模型,用于数字孪生场景。
  • 地图渲染:使用地图服务(如OpenLayers、Leaflet)渲染地理数据,展示数据的空间分布。

优化策略

实时数据融合与渲染的性能优化是确保系统高效运行的关键。以下是一些常见的优化策略:

1. 数据压缩与编码

在数据传输和存储过程中,数据量的大小直接影响系统的性能。通过数据压缩和编码技术可以有效减少数据量,提升系统效率。

  • 压缩算法:使用Gzip、Snappy等压缩算法对数据进行压缩。
  • 编码格式:使用JSON、Protobuf等轻量级编码格式对数据进行编码。

2. 分布式渲染

对于大规模数据场景,单机渲染可能会导致性能瓶颈。通过分布式渲染技术可以将渲染任务分发到多个节点,提升渲染效率。

  • 分布式计算框架:使用Spark、Flink等分布式计算框架进行数据处理和渲染。
  • 负载均衡:通过负载均衡技术将渲染任务分发到多个渲染节点,确保系统性能的稳定性。

3. 算法优化

在数据融合和渲染过程中,算法的效率直接影响系统的性能。通过优化算法可以提升系统的响应速度和处理能力。

  • 数据融合算法:使用高效的融合算法(如基于图的融合算法)提升数据融合的效率。
  • 渲染算法:使用光线追踪、阴影映射等优化算法提升渲染效果和效率。

应用场景

实时数据融合与渲染技术在多个领域有广泛的应用,以下是一些典型场景:

1. 数据中台

数据中台是企业级的数据中枢,通过实时数据融合与渲染技术可以将多源数据整合为统一的数据视图,为企业提供实时洞察。

  • 数据整合:将来自不同系统的数据整合为统一的数据视图。
  • 实时分析:通过实时数据分析技术对数据进行实时监控和预测。

2. 数字孪生

数字孪生是通过数字模型对物理世界进行实时模拟的技术,广泛应用于智慧城市、智能制造等领域。

  • 三维建模:通过3D建模技术创建物理世界的数字模型。
  • 实时渲染:通过实时渲染技术将数字模型动态更新,反映物理世界的实时状态。

3. 实时可视化

实时可视化通过将数据动态呈现为企业用户提供直观的决策支持。

  • 实时监控:通过实时监控界面展示关键业务指标的实时变化。
  • 动态交互:通过交互式可视化技术让用户与数据进行实时互动。

工具与平台推荐

为了帮助企业更好地实现实时数据融合与渲染,以下是一些常用的工具和平台:

  • Apache NiFi:一个开源的数据集成平台,支持实时数据流的采集、处理和传输。
  • Grafana:一个开源的监控和可视化平台,支持多种数据源的实时数据可视化。
  • Three.js:一个流行的3D图形库,支持WebGL渲染技术,广泛应用于数字孪生场景。

申请试用


结论

实时数据融合与渲染技术是数字化转型中的重要能力,能够帮助企业将复杂的数据转化为直观的可视化界面,为决策者提供实时洞察。通过合理的技术实现和优化策略,企业可以充分发挥实时数据的价值,提升业务效率和竞争力。

申请试用

希望本文能为您提供有价值的技术指导和实践参考!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料